Transaction 5b90724486d044fbd920c41dafaa65b9cd0b81bfef2a16366737aa95eb9813bd

189 Input
2 Outputs
  • 5b90724486d044fbd920c41dafaa65b9cd0b81bfef2a16366737aa95eb9813bd:0
  • value  3058053666
    address  34dwP9evkCPRaaxoPSA6G72r2SiyvAjvCL
  • 5b90724486d044fbd920c41dafaa65b9cd0b81bfef2a16366737aa95eb9813bd:1
  • value  967249
    address  32WUvTXfTQcZzTZP8xSaGdKWL4BCUgmrwq